Heavy equipment will not participate in the Victory Day Parade on May 9 in Moscow. This is reported by the Ministry of Defense of the Russian Federation.
Suvorov, Nakhimov and cadet corps students will also not take part in the event.
"Pupils of the Suvorov military and Nakhimov schools, cadet corps, as well as a column of military equipment will not take part in the military parade this year due to the current operational situation," the report said.
According to the Ministry of Defense, military personnel of military universities of all and individual branches of the armed forces will be in the column.
During the broadcast of the parade, the work of military personnel will be demonstrated The Armed Forces of the Russian Federation of all types and types of troops performing tasks in the SMO zone, as well as those on combat duty and combat service, including as part of calculations at the control points of the Strategic Missile Forces, the Aerospace Forces and on Navy ships.
Aerobatic aircraft of air groups will fly over Red Square, and at the end of the parade, pilots of Su-25 attack aircraft will paint the sky of Moscow in the colors of the Russian flag.
